They start by prepping the surfaces, which means cleaning off any dirt, mildew, or peeling paint. This step is crucial for the new paint to stick properly and last. Then, they'll apply primer where needed, especially on bare wood or stained areas. This ensures a uniform base coat and better color coverage for your Everett home. The actual painting involves applying one or two top coats, depending on the paint and color chosen. They focus on getting even coverage on siding, trim, and any other exterior features. What affects the price

When you get a quote for exterior painting, the total depends on a few practical things. The size and height of your home are the biggest factors—a multi-story house takes more time and safety equipment. The current condition of your siding also matters; if there is significant peeling, wood rot, or mold, that area needs extra prep work before a brush ever touches it. Summer offers the best conditions for drying, but extreme heat can be an issue. If it’s too hot, paint might dry too quickly, which keeps it from bonding to the surface. We often schedule painting for earlier in the day to avoid the peak afternoon sun and keep the finish looking smooth.

What kind of Sherwin-Williams paint samples should I get for my Everett house?

When selecting Sherwin-Williams paint samples for your Everett home, consider the natural light it receives throughout the day. For exteriors, think about how the color will appear in both bright sun and overcast conditions, which are common here. Bring the samples outside to your house and observe them at different times. This helps you avoid surprises with how the color truly looks on your specific siding and trim in Everett's unique lighting.

What's the difference between gouache paint and exterior house paint for Everett homes?

Gouache paint is a water-based opaque paint often used for illustrations and fine art on paper or canvas. It is not formulated for exterior use on homes in Everett. Exterior house paints are specifically designed to withstand UV rays, moisture, temperature fluctuations, and mildew. They contain binders and pigments that provide durability and protection against the weather conditions experienced in Everett throughout the year.
